/// <reference path="../pb_data/types.d.ts" />
|
||||
//
|
||||
// M3 — Promote financial fields out of the `financial` JSON blob into real
|
||||
// numeric columns on `repairOrders`. This lets the FinancialDashboard run
|
||||
// server-side `sum()` aggregations instead of pulling every completed RO to
|
||||
// the client. It also makes the values type-safe and queryable.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// New columns: grossTotal, grossCost, warrTotal, warrCost, shopCharge.
|
||||
// (shopCharge overlaps conceptually with the existing `shopCharges` column —
|
||||
// see the migration doc. Here we add `shopCharge` as a separate field to
|
||||
// match the financial-blob key the frontend currently writes. If you prefer
|
||||
// to consolidate, point the frontend at `shopCharges` instead and skip this
|
||||
// field.)
|
||||
//
|
||||
migrate(
|
||||
(db) => {
|
||||
const col = db.findCollectionByNameOrId('repairOrders');
|
||||
if (!col) {
|
||||
console.warn('[M3] repairOrders collection not found — skipping');
|
||||
return;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
for (const name of ['grossTotal', 'grossCost', 'warrTotal', 'warrCost', 'shopCharge']) {
|
||||
if (!col.fields.find((f) => f.name === name)) {
|
||||
col.fields.push(new NumberField({ name, required: false, min: 0 }));
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
db.save(col);
|
||||
console.log('[M3] added financial numeric fields');
|
||||
|
||||
const records = Array.from(db.findRecordsByFilter(
|
||||
"repairOrders",
|
||||
"1=1",
|
||||
"id",
|
||||
500
|
||||
));
|
||||
let backfilled = 0;
|
||||
for (const rec of records) {
|
||||
let fin = {};
|
||||
try {
|
||||
const raw = rec.get('financial');
|
||||
if (typeof raw === 'string' && raw.trim()) {
|
||||
fin = JSON.parse(raw);
|
||||
} else if (raw && typeof raw === 'object') {
|
||||
fin = raw;
|
||||
}
|
||||
} catch { /* ignore corrupt blobs */ }
|
||||
|
||||
let changed = false;
|
||||
for (const [srcKey, dstKey] of [
|
||||
['grossTotal', 'grossTotal'],
|
||||
['grossCost', 'grossCost'],
|
||||
['warrTotal', 'warrTotal'],
|
||||
['warrCost', 'warrCost'],
|
||||
['shopCharge', 'shopCharge'],
|
||||
]) {
|
||||
const v = Number(fin && fin[srcKey]);
|
||||
if (!Number.isNaN(v) && rec.get(dstKey) == null) {
|
||||
rec.set(dstKey, v || 0);
|
||||
changed = true;
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
if (changed) {
|
||||
db.saveRecord(rec);
|
||||
backfilled++;
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
console.log(`[M3] backfilled ${backfilled} records`);
|
||||
},
|
||||
(db) => {
|
||||
const col = db.findCollectionByNameOrId('repairOrders');
|
||||
if (!col) return;
|
||||
for (const name of ['grossTotal', 'grossCost', 'warrTotal', 'warrCost', 'shopCharge']) {
|
||||
const idx = col.fields.findIndex((f) => f.name === name);
|
||||
if (idx >= 0) col.fields.splice(idx, 1);
|
||||
}
|
||||
db.save(col);
|
||||
}
|
||||
);
